Is management still a profession or, as some believe, a role that will become obsolete as society and organizations evolve?
This was the question debated at an event presenting a Lucca study on the professional aspirations of the French (The French and work: changing aspirations and worsening conditions). Experts faced off in battles on three of the study's themes: do companies makes people incompetent, is pursuing a career still desirable, and finally is manager still a job or, as some think, a role that will become obsolete in the light of changes in society...
